Where Urable is still a strong pick

Multi-vertical shops running detail + tint + audio + wheels under one roof, or franchises / multi-location operators who need Urable's multi-shop tooling. If the breadth is the main unlock, DetailingStack's detailing-only focus is the wrong tradeoff for you.
